   Lieutenant Phillip Morris suffered a fatal heart attack while engaged in a foot pursuit of a suspect on the Vincennes University campus.

   He was transported to Good Samaritan Hospital where he passed away.

   Lieutenant Morris, from Vincennes, was survived by his wife, two daughters, mother, two brothers, two sisters and four grandchildren.

Historical Notes

• Lieutenant Morris is the first known campus law enforcement line of duty death in Indiana.
• Vincennes University was permitted by state law to establish its own police department in 1971.
